dt-bindings: ipmi: Add optional SerIRQ property to ASPEED KCS devices
authorAndrew Jeffery <andrew@aj.id.au>
Tue, 8 Jun 2021 10:47:54 +0000 (20:17 +0930)
committerCorey Minyard <cminyard@mvista.com>
Tue, 22 Jun 2021 00:50:34 +0000 (19:50 -0500)
commita7fd43d95054fe03cac3878538dcf12caa854889
tree06faf6e8a42a176935361a62d44b4b51959aaee9
parente880275ccfa120bf6235180ca76f01271b7b97ec
dt-bindings: ipmi: Add optional SerIRQ property to ASPEED KCS devices

Allocating IO and IRQ resources to LPC devices is in-theory an operation
for the host, however ASPEED don't appear to expose this capability
outside the BMC (e.g. SuperIO). Instead, we are left with BMC-internal
registers for managing these resources, so introduce a devicetree
property for KCS devices to describe SerIRQ properties.

Signed-off-by: Andrew Jeffery <andrew@aj.id.au>
Reviewed-by: Rob Herring <robh@kernel.org>
Message-Id: <20210608104757.582199-14-andrew@aj.id.au>
Signed-off-by: Corey Minyard <cminyard@mvista.com>
Documentation/devicetree/bindings/ipmi/aspeed,ast2400-kcs-bmc.yaml